Our Process
Every sack of Taj Bahar rice carries the story of a precise, unhurried journey — from hand-selected paddy to laboratory-certified perfection.
We partner exclusively with certified farmers in the Haryana and Punjab belts — the only regions where true basmati can grow. Every crop season is personally supervised.
Raw paddy is aged in our climate-controlled silos for 18 to 24 months. This intensifies the signature aroma and ensures grains expand fully upon cooking.
State-of-the-art sortex and colour-sorting machines remove any impurity. Our zero-breakage policy ensures you receive only whole, pristine grains.
Every batch is tested for moisture content, grain length, aroma grade, and pesticide residue before hermetically sealed packaging for preservation.
